The public are being asked to keep their eyes peeled for a kestrel that has been missing for more than two days.
Six-year-old Noddy flew off during an exercise session at Great Hollands recreation ground in Bracknell, Berkshire, on Saturday afternoon and did not return to his falconer.
Angela Norwood, who runs Berkshire Birds of Prey, said Noddy “got spooked” when he was chased by a group of magpies.
She believes he has remained close to the area and has been spotted around Buckler’s Forest nature reserve, The Golden Retriever pub in Nine Mile Ride and, most recently, near Lyon Road in Buckler’s Park.
